G affected. 2) For continuous configurations,onnector Purlin are connected together using three sets of 3/8" flange bolt, washers (-/2"), and serrated flange nuts at each end of the Purlins. Torque to specifications. t is important that the correct washers are used. 3) f required Purlin-to-Beam and Purlin-to-Purlin Straps will be installed using 3/8" bolts and flange nuts. Torque to specifications. t is very important that the Purlin-to-Beam and Purlin-to-Purlin Supports are taut. ssue: By: Date: Description: SA Fifth Avenue, 6th Floor New York, NY 009 Tel: ) At least three days after concrete is poured, drill two inch (4 ) diameter weep holes on opposite ends of each of the Tub walls, centered 2" above the ground level, centered on wall of Tub the long way. This enables water to drain out. ) Attach first panel to EW Purlin through mounting holes nearest to NS Beam. Place a star washer at one mounting location per panel. nsert hex bolt through the Purlin, the mounting hole on the back of the panel, and then through the star washer. Attach with a serrated flange nuts on the bolt end inside the panel. heck again to make sure star washer is still in place. Torque to specifications. f panel mounting hole diameter or slot width is 0.28 or less, the orientation of the bolt and nut can be flipped such that the stackup order from top to bottom is: hex bolt head, star washer, panel frame mounting hole, Z Purlin mounting hole, and flange nut. Repeat for all panels ) For bottom mount attachment of panels Gamehange typically provides slotted panel mounting holes to enable panel adjustment in case purlins are not perfectly aligned due to rolling or otherwise uneven ground situations. t is the customer's responsibility to make sure to follow panel spacing guidelines if any are given by panel vendor in their specification sheet or elsewhere, otherwise panel warranty could be voided. n all cases make sure panel spacing is the greater of /8 inch or the minimum called out by the panel vendor. This will allow for thermal expansion of panels. Gamehange systems typically enable /2 inch panel spacing if aligned properly. Spacing between panels can be set by placing a temporary spacer such as bolt shaft or plywood of same thickness as required for panel spacing between panels while they are being installed. This spacer should be removed after panel installation is complete. 20) The modules, EW Purlins and NS Beams are all bonded together, left to right, so each row forms one single structure. Gamehange recommends 6 strings be grounded on one grounding lug, which should be attached at the hole provided next to the marking "GROUND". nstall ooper, Burndy, or Eaton UL approved grounding lug with /4-inch bolts as in accordance with NE Article 690 to the end of the last EW Purlin which has panels attached to it which are to be bonded, using 8 gauge copper wire.
